Bible Verses About Taking Opportunities
Embracing New Experiences
In our lives, we are often called to step beyond our comfort zones and embrace new experiences that God places before us. The Bible teaches us that these moments can be gateways to growth and new beginnings. By being open to new opportunities, we allow ourselves to be vessels of God’s love and light in the world. Each chance we take can lead us to deeper faith and stronger connections with others.
Isaiah 43:19
“See, I am doing a new thing! Now it springs up; do you not perceive it? I am making a way in the wilderness and streams in the wasteland.” – Isaiah 43:19
This verse is a beautiful reminder that God is always at work in our lives. It encourages us to open our eyes to the new opportunities that God presents, inviting us to trust Him as He guides us through challenging times.
2 Corinthians 5:17
“Therefore, if anyone is in Christ, the new creation has come: The old has gone, the new is here!” – 2 Corinthians 5:17
In Christ, we are made new! This verse inspires us to let go of our past and embrace the new beginnings that God has prepared for us. Every opportunity is a chance to step into our true identity as God’s beloved children.
Revelation 21:5
“He who was seated on the throne said, ‘I am making everything new!’ Then he said, ‘Write this down, for these words are trustworthy and true.'” – Revelation 21:5
This verse reassures us that God is in the business of renewal and restoration. When we face new opportunities, we can rest in the promise that God is actively making things new in our lives.
Lamentations 3:22-23
“Because of the Lord’s great love we are not consumed, for his compassions never fail. They are new every morning; great is your faithfulness.” – Lamentations 3:22-23
This verse reminds us that God’s love brings new mercies each day. With every sunrise comes a fresh opportunity to experience His goodness and grace in our lives.
Philippians 3:13-14
“Brothers and sisters, I do not consider myself yet to have taken hold of it. But one thing I do: Forgetting what is behind and straining toward what is ahead, I press on toward the goal to win the prize for which God has called me heavenward in Christ Jesus.” – Philippians 3:13-14
This passage encourages us to focus on the future rather than dwell on the past. It calls us to take hold of the opportunities God places in front of us, striving for the calling He’s placed on our lives.
Stepping Out in Faith
Taking opportunities often requires us to step out in faith. This means trusting God, even when we feel uncertain. The Bible reminds us that faith is a powerful tool that can lead us to incredible experiences. We must remember that God is with us every step of the way, encouraging us to move forward and embrace the future He has in store.
Hebrews 11:1
“Now faith is confidence in what we hope for and assurance about what we do not see.” – Hebrews 11:1
This verse defines faith as confidence in God’s promises. Taking opportunities often means stepping into the unknown. We can trust that God will guide us through uncertain times with His faithful presence.
James 1:5
“If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you.” – James 1:5
In times of decision-making, we can rely on God’s wisdom. When considering new opportunities, we can boldly seek His guidance, knowing He will generously provide us with wisdom to discern the right path.
Psalm 37:5
“Commit your way to the Lord; trust in him and he will do this:” – Psalm 37:5
This verse encourages us to place our plans in God’s hands. When we take opportunities, we should trust Him with our steps, believing that He will lead us towards His purpose for our lives.
Proverbs 3:5-6
“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ways submit to him, and he will make your paths straight.” – Proverbs 3:5-6
This exhortation reminds us to lean on God rather than our understanding. Taking opportunities often involves a level of trust. We can find peace in knowing our paths will be made clear by God’s loving direction.
Matthew 17:20
“He replied, ‘Because you have so little faith. Truly I tell you, if you have faith as small as a mustard seed, you can say to this mountain, Move from here to there, and it will move. Nothing will be impossible for you.'” – Matthew 17:20
This verse challenges us to have even a small amount of faith. Taking opportunities can sometimes feel daunting, yet with just a little faith, we can accomplish great things through God’s power.
Overcoming Fear
Fear can often hold us back from fully embracing the opportunities God has for us. However, the Bible offers us plenty of encouragement to face our fears and step boldly into what God has called us to. We must remind ourselves that God’s love casts out all fear, allowing us to seize every opportunity that comes our way.
Isaiah 41:10
“So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.” – Isaiah 41:10
This verse reassures us of God’s presence and support. When opportunities arise, we need not fear, for God stands with us, ready to strengthen us as we step into new experiences.
1 John 4:18
“There is no fear in love. But perfect love drives out fear, because fear has to do with punishment. The one who fears is not made perfect in love.” – 1 John 4:18
We are reminded that God’s love dispels fear. When we take opportunities, we can do so confidently, knowing that God’s perfect love is there to guide us and protect us from fear’s grasp.
Psalm 56:3
“When I am afraid, I put my trust in you.” – Psalm 56:3
This verse teaches us to trust God in our moments of fear. When opportunities present themselves, we can find comfort in placing our fear in God’s capable hands and trusting His guidance.
John 14:27
“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. I do not give to you as the world gives. Do not let your hearts be troubled and do not be afraid.” – John 14:27
Jesus offers us a peace that surpasses understanding. When we are faced with opportunities that make us anxious, we can rely on His peace, calming our hearts and encouraging us to move forward without fear.
2 Timothy 1:7
“For God has not given us a spirit of fear, but of power, love, and self-discipline.” – 2 Timothy 1:7
This verse empowers us to move beyond fear. God equips us with strength, love, and discipline, enabling us to seize the opportunities He provides with confidence and courage.
Acting with Purpose
As we take opportunities, we should do so with purpose and intention. God has plans for each of us, and every opportunity is a chance to fulfill His calling. We can find joy and excitement in knowing that our actions align with God’s greater purpose, allowing us to make a positive difference in the world.
Ephesians 2:10
“For we are God’s handiwork, created in Christ Jesus to do good works, which God prepared in advance for us to do.” – Ephesians 2:10
This verse emphasizes that we are designed for good works. Every opportunity we seize is a chance to fulfill the purpose God has for us, shining His light in our communities.
Colossians 3:23
“Whatever you do, work at it with all your heart, as working for the Lord, not for human masters.” – Colossians 3:23
When we act with purpose, we give our best efforts to all we do. Each opportunity is a chance to honor God with our work and actions, reflecting His love to those around us.
Matthew 5:16
“In the same way, let your light shine before others, that they may see your good deeds and glorify your Father in heaven.” – Matthew 5:16
This verse encourages us to let our light shine in every opportunity. Our actions can inspire others, leading them to glorify God through the work we do and the love we share.
Acts 20:24
“However, I consider my life worth nothing to me; my only aim is to finish the race and complete the task the Lord Jesus has given me—the task of testifying to the good news of God’s grace.” – Acts 20:24
This passage reveals the purpose behind our opportunities. We should aim to complete the tasks God has set for us, which often involve sharing His grace and love with others.
1 Corinthians 10:31
“So whether you eat or drink or whatever you do, do it all for the glory of God.” – 1 Corinthians 10:31
This verse reminds us that all our actions, even the smallest ones, should be done with the intention of glorifying God. Every opportunity allows us to reflect our gratitude for His blessings.
Building Relationships
Taking opportunities is not just about personal growth; it also brings us closer to others. Our relationships can flourish as we embrace possibilities together. The Bible encourages us to utilize every chance to strengthen our connections, share love, and serve others in His name.
Galatians 6:2
“Carry each other’s burdens, and in this way you will fulfill the law of Christ.” – Galatians 6:2
This verse highlights the importance of supporting one another. Every opportunity to help a friend or neighbor strengthens our relationships and reflects the love of Christ.
Proverbs 27:17
“As iron sharpens iron, so one person sharpens another.” – Proverbs 27:17
This verse emphasizes how relationships can help us grow. As we take opportunities to connect with others, we can encourage one another towards spiritual growth and maturity.
Romans 12:10
“Be devoted to one another in love. Honor one another above yourselves.” – Romans 12:10
We are called to love and honor one another. Taking the opportunity to show love towards others strengthens our bonds and fulfills the command to love our neighbors.
Philippians 1:3
“I thank my God every time I remember you.” – Philippians 1:3
This verse encourages us to express gratitude for others. Every opportunity we have to connect with those we care about brings joy and enriches our relationships.
Hebrews 10:24-25
“And let us consider how we may spur one another on toward love and good deeds, not giving up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ing, but encouraging one another—and all the more as you see the Day approaching.” – Hebrews 10:24-25
This passage reminds us of the importance of community. By taking opportunities to gather with fellow believers, we can encourage one another in our faith journeys and grow together in Christ.
Serving Others
One of the most beautiful ways to take opportunities is through serving others. The Bible encourages us to seek out chances to bless those around us. By doing so, we reflect Christ’s love and fulfill His calling for our lives. Every act of service can make a difference in someone’s life.
Mark 10:45
“For even the Son of Man did not come to be served, but to serve, and to give his life as a ransom for many.” – Mark 10:45
Jesus modeled the ultimate act of service. When we take opportunities to serve others, we follow His example, showing that love is expressed through our actions.
Matthew 25:40
“The King will reply, ‘Truly I tell you, whatever you did for one of the least of these brothers and sisters of mine, you did for me.'” – Matthew 25:40
This verse teaches us about the value of serving those in need. Every opportunity we take to help someone is a chance to serve Christ Himself, creating a ripple effect of love in the world.
1 Peter 4:10
“Each of you should use whatever gift you have received to serve others, as faithful stewards of God’s grace in its various forms.” – 1 Peter 4:10
We are reminded to use our gifts for service. Each opportunity is a chance to share our talents and bless others, fulfilling God’s purpose in our lives.
Romans 12:13
“Share with the Lord’s people who are in need. Practice hospitality.” – Romans 12:13
This verse encourages us to be generous and hospitable. Taking opportunities to meet the needs of others is a practical expression of love and compassion.
Galatians 5:13
“You, my brothers and sisters, were called to be free. But do not use your freedom to indulge the flesh; rather, serve one another humbly in love.” – Galatians 5:13
We are called to serve one another in love. Every opportunity to do good is an invitation to embody the humble spirit of Christ, spreading His love wherever we go.
